Job Description The Environmental Manager - Manufacturing will be responsible for the following: Oversee all environmental programs for multiple manufacturing facilities, including air, water, waste, hazardous materials, and spill prevention. Ensure company-wide compliance with environmental laws and regulations (EPA, RCRA, CAA, CWA, TSCA, etc.). Develop, implement, and manage site-specific and corporate-wide environmental policies, procedures, and reporting systems. Lead environmental audits, inspections, risk assessments, and corrective actions. Coordinate and submit required environmental permits, reports, and documentation to regulatory agencies. Provide technical guidance and training to site-level EHS teams and operations personnel. Develop and track KPIs related to environmental performance, compliance, and sustainability goals. Partner with operations, maintenance, engineering, and leadership to integrate environmental best practices into daily operations and capital projects. Stay current with regulatory changes and industry trends; communicate potential impacts to stakeholders. Manage environmental consultants and vendors as needed for site assessments, remediation, or specialized services. Support corporate sustainability and ESG initiatives, including Scope 1-3 emissions tracking, waste minimization, and resource efficiency projects. The Successful Applicant The ideal Environmental Manager - Manufacturing will have the following qualifications: Bachelor's degree in Environmental Science, Environmental Engineering, or related field (Master's preferred). 7+ years of progressive environmental experience in a manufacturing or industrial setting, including multi-site oversight. Managerial experience Strong knowledge of U.S. environmental regulations and permitting processes. Proven success leading environmental compliance and sustainability programs. Experience managing relationships with regulatory agencies. Excellent organizational, analytical, and communication skills. Ability to travel up to 30% to manufacturing sites. Professional certifications (e.g., CHMM, QEP, CESM, RCRA, HAZWOPER, DOT Hazardous Waste). Experience with ISO 14001 or other environmental management systems. Familiarity with sustainability frameworks (e.g., GHG Protocol, CDP, TCFD).
